The Greeley contractor market in 2026

Greeley in 2026 is not a sleepy town and it is not Denver. It is its own thing. The city and the wider Greeley Evans metro keep growing. Residential permits are strong and the permit rate per 1,000 residents is well above state and national averages, which signals a steady pipeline of work for local contractors across Weld County. At the same time, construction employment has dipped a few percent year over year, so there are fewer people trying to cover more work. That creates pressure on every owner and dispatcher to do more with the crew they already have.

On the ground, that looks like:

  • New subdivisions near Windsor, Evans, and Johnstown that need HVAC, plumbing, electrical, and landscaping support from day one.
  • Older homes around downtown Greeley and the UNC campus that need replacements, retrofits, and emergency repair work, often from price sensitive renters and working families.
  • Agricultural and light industrial properties across Weld County that still need reliable local trades to keep operations running.

The repeal of large projects like Cascadia has created uncertainty for bigger commercial players, but it has not stopped roofs from leaking or furnaces from failing on a cold night near the Poudre. For small and mid‑sized contractors, the opportunity is in being the local team that always answers first and shows up when it matters.

Specific Greeley trade use cases where AI quietly does the heavy lifting

HVAC for older downtown and UNC housing

Many homes and rentals near downtown and the UNC campus have aging furnaces and patchwork cooling solutions. When those systems fail, tenants and property managers want help fast and they often start with a quick search on their phone. AI can:

  • Capture after‑hours calls and offer emergency visit windows by text.
  • Ask a few triage questions automatically, so your techs arrive better prepared.
  • Send follow up reminders for seasonal maintenance to reduce surprise breakdowns.

Roofing for hail‑prone Weld County neighborhoods

When a hailstorm rolls across the high plains, phones light up from Greeley to Eaton. Roofers cannot answer every call in real time. AI can log each address, send a quick text with an inspection time window, and keep homeowners informed as your crews move across the county. That keeps work organized and shows neighbors you respect their time and property even on chaotic days.

Landscaping for new residential developments

In subdivisions between Greeley, Evans, and Windsor, one new yard often turns into five more. AI helps by tracking every quote, sending polite follow ups, and asking for reviews from happy customers. Those reviews, especially when they mention specific neighborhoods and streets, are what push you ahead of out‑of‑area competitors in local search results for the next round of homeowners.

FAQ: AI automation for Greeley contractors

How can contractors in Greeley CO start using AI without rebuilding their whole tech stack?

Start with one or two clear problems. For most shops that means missed calls and slow follow up. You can layer AI on top of your existing phone number and calendar so that when a call or form comes in, an AI assistant responds immediately, books appointments into your current system, and keeps a log for your team. There is no need to switch CRMs or rebuild your website to see value from AI for home service contractors Greeley wide.

Is AI automation worth the cost for smaller Greeley contractors?

For many small teams, one extra job per month covers typical AI automation cost and then some. When you factor in saved time on manual follow up and fewer lost leads to outside competitors, the math usually works in your favor. The key is starting with a focused setup that directly supports revenue, like lead capture and booking, rather than trying to automate everything at once.

Will AI make my contracting business feel less personal to Greeley customers?

It does not have to. The best implementations feel like a helpful office assistant, not a robot. You can customize language, reference Greeley and nearby towns by name, and make sure the AI hands off to a real person as soon as the homeowner wants to talk. Used this way, AI protects the human side of your business by giving you room to focus on conversations and job quality instead of chasing voicemails.
